Water productivity, total (constant 2015 US$ GDP per cubic meter of) in Slovenia
Slovenia: Water productivity, total (constant 2015 US$ GDP per cubic meter of) was 64.55 in 2022. ▲ Rising
Water productivity, total (constant 2015 US$ GDP per cubic meter of) in Slovenia, 2002–2022
Source: AQUASTAT - FAO's Global Information System on Water and Agriculture, Food and Agriculture Organization of the United Nations (FAO), publisher: Food and Agriculture Organization of the United Nations (.
Analysis
The most recent figure for water productivity, total (constant 2015 us$ gdp per cubic meter of) in Slovenia is 64.55, measured in 2022. That is the highest value across all 21 years on record.
The figure is up 15.6% on the previous year and up 46.4% over ten years.
Over the whole period, water productivity, total (constant 2015 us$ gdp per cubic meter of) in Slovenia peaked at 64.55 in 2022 and was at its lowest, 35.12, in 2013.
Slovenia ranks 53rd of 179 countries on this measure, in the middle of the range.
The long-run direction has been consistently rising across the 21 years of available data.
Water productivity, total (constant 2015 US$ GDP per cubic meter of) in Slovenia, year by year
| Year | Value | Change |
|---|---|---|
| 2002 | 37.93 | — |
| 2003 | 38.79 | +2.3% |
| 2004 | 40.19 | +3.6% |
| 2005 | 41.37 | +2.9% |
| 2006 | 43.54 | +5.2% |
| 2007 | 46.36 | +6.5% |
| 2008 | 43.1 | -7.0% |
| 2009 | 43.94 | +1.9% |
| 2010 | 45.25 | +3.0% |
| 2011 | 49.58 | +9.6% |
| 2012 | 44.1 | -11.0% |
| 2013 | 35.12 | -20.4% |
| 2014 | 42.55 | +21.1% |
| 2015 | 47.61 | +11.9% |
| 2016 | 49.59 | +4.2% |
| 2017 | 49.69 | +0.2% |
| 2018 | 50.27 | +1.2% |
| 2019 | 52.97 | +5.4% |
| 2020 | 47.82 | -9.7% |
| 2021 | 55.85 | +16.8% |
| 2022 | 64.55 | +15.6% |

About this data
Water productivity is calculated as GDP in constant prices divided by annual total water withdrawal.
